15 Del. C. § 5712: Representative in the Congress of the United States; announcement and certification of election.

(a) The Governor, after receiving the certificates of the results of the election in each county for Representative in the Congress of the United States, shall without delay examine these certificates and declare the individual elected, and shall issue certificates of the election, 1 of which the Governor shall transmit to the Secretary of State of the United States, and 1 to the individual elected, under the Governor’s own hand and the Great Seal of the State.

(b) The Governor shall file the certificates of the result of the election in each county under subsection (a) of this section in the office of the Secretary of State.

(c) The Governor shall by proclamation make public the state of the vote by publishing the certificates of the results in 1 or more of the public newspapers of this State.
